Approved for medical and ITE applications, this range of forced and convection cooled single output AC/DC power supplies are packaged in an ultra compact foot print of just 5.0” by 3.0”. The ECH450 provides up to 450W force cooled and 250W convection cooled leading to very high power densities of 20W/in 3. A 12V , 600 mA fan supply is included in the design to faciliate system cooling, along with 5 V/1 A standby output. The power supply contains two fuses and low leakage currents as required by medical applications and is safety approved to operate in a 70°C ambient. The ECH450 series is designed to minimize the no load power consumption and maximize efficiency to facilitate equipment design to meet the latest environmental legislation and the low profile and safety approvals covering ITE and medical standards along with conducted emissions to EN55011/32 level B allow the versatile ECH450 series to be used in a vast range of applications.
- Force cooled and convection cooled ratings
- Medical and ITE approvals
- Compact 3.0” by 5.0” footprint
- Suitable for BF applications
- 5 V standby and remote on/off
- 12 V fan output
- -20 °C to +70 °C operation

ECH 450 Series AC -D C Pow er Supplies 11 w w w .xppow er.com 26 March 20 Figure 6 Estimated Service Life vs Component Temperature 10000 20000 30000 40000 50000 Lifetime (Hrs) C5 + C39 T emperature (ºC) C39 C5 60000 70000 80000 105 95 85 75 65 55 45 Service Life The estim ated service life of the EC H 4 50 is determ ined by the cooling arrangem ents and load conditions experienced in the end application. Due to the uncertain nature of the end application this estim ated service life is based on the actual m easured tem perature of a key capacitor w ith in the product w hen installed by the end application, The graph below expresses the estim ated lifetim e of a given com ponent tem perature and assum es continuous operation at this tem perature. In order to ensure safe operation of the PSU in the end-use equipm ent, the tem perature of the com ponents listed in the table below m ust not be exceeded. T em perature should be m onitored using K type therm ocouples placed on the hottest part of the com ponent (out of direct air flow ). See Standard O pen Fram e M echanical Details on page 5 for com ponent locations.
